Leroy Engert on Coaching Philosophy (Covering the Bases)

LEROY ENGERT: They were looking for a head coach. The program, really, was down quite a bit. To me, I took that as a challenge to go in there and try to, so-called, turn that program around. You don’t do that by yourself. You need cooperation from the administration all the way down to your assistant coaches and then your players and your parents. I think that I’m not a parent-oriented person, I’m a player-oriented person. I think that sometimes nowadays we cater to parents a little bit more. It’s parent-oriented, and it shouldn’t be. It ought to be player-oriented. I see a lot of that in little leagues as I go out and watch little league baseball. I would think, let the kid go enjoy what he is trying to do. If he wins, great. If he loses, that’s great too, because he’s learned from that experience. I see a lot of parents have a negative reaction because their son lost, or a little boy struck out with the bases loaded. Who feels worse than that little kid? That’s when he needs a pat on the back. That was the type of philosophy that I tried to carry with working with young people. More constructive criticism, rather than just criticism, per se. Where you really talked about things that they did well, and you come in the backdoor and now you try to influence them a little bit about some of the things that they needed to work on.
